  1. What is latitude?Distance north or south of the equator
  2. How can GIS help?It layers and analyzes location data
  3. What is a renewable resource?One replenished naturally on a human time scale
  4. Why do settlements form near rivers?Water, transport, food, and fertile land
  5. What is population density?People per unit of area
  6. How can mountains make a rain shadow?Air loses moisture, then descends drier
  7. What is longitude?Distance east or west of the prime meridian
  8. What is urbanization?Growth in the share of people living in cities
